I have just tried to install fedora core 3 64 bit on a system with via
sata 8237 chipset and sata disk, and it failes 4 times. I installed an
alternative IDE disk and it worked fine.
After installation from bootable DVD to the sata disk, a reboot fails to
start the secondary install procedures (licence agrrement, date/time,
video setup, user setup etc. The sata install just hangs at this point
after the very first line in boot messages:
Initializing hardware - storage network audio >>> hang
a control c gets past this, but then the disk system is read only and
the boot fails.
I see there was some discussion of this back in January 2004 on core 1
and core 2 - but there still seems to be an issue with installation onto
a sata disk on an 8237 controller.
